The beginning inventory was 400 units at a cost of $11 per unit. Goods available for sale during the year were 1,600 units at a total cost of $19,300. In May, 700 units were purchased at a total cost of $8,400. The only other purchase transaction occurred during October. Ending inventory was 700 units. Required: a. Calculate the number of units purchased in October and the cost per unit purchased in October. Purchased in October Number of units Cost per unit
